#3bf78e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3bf78e is composed of 23.1% red, 96.9%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.5%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 146.5 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 60%. #3bf78e color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ffff with #00ef1d.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#3bf78e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3bf78e has RGB values of R:59, G:247,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 3929998.

Shades and Tints of #3bf78e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b05 is the darkest color, while #f7fff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#3bf78e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#91a198 is the less saturated color, while #33ff8d is the most saturated one.
